2004 BMW Z4 vs. 1986 BMW M5

To start off, 2004 BMW Z4 is newer by 18 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 BMW M5.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 BMW M5 would be higher. At 3,428 cc (6 cylinders), 1986 BMW M5 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1986 BMW M5 (218 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 50 more horse power than 2004 BMW Z4. (168 HP @ 6250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1986 BMW M5 should accelerate faster than 2004 BMW Z4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1986 BMW M5 weights approximately 194 kg more than 2004 BMW Z4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1986 BMW M5 (310 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 100 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 BMW Z4. (210 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1986 BMW M5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 BMW Z4. 1986 BMW M5 has automatic transmission and 2004 BMW Z4 has manual transmission. 2004 BMW Z4 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1986 BMW M5 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2004 BMW Z4 1986 BMW M5
Make BMW BMW
Model Z4 M5
Year Released 2004 1986
Body Type Convertible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2171 cc 3428 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 168 HP 218 HP
Engine RPM 6250 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 210 Nm 310 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 4000 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 10.8:1 10.0:1
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1325 kg 1519 kg
Vehicle Length 4100 mm 4630 mm
Vehicle Width 1790 mm 1710 mm
Vehicle Height 1310 mm 1300 mm
Wheelbase Size 2500 mm 2630 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 55 L 120 L
